Hello Mano;

Your tree is certainly a species of Erythrina, often called coral trees.  Given that you are in South Africa, this is likely Erythina caffra, as it is native to your area and is commonly grown as a flowering ornamental tree in tropical areas around the world.  But please know there are many species of Erythina and I cannot guess at the specific identification of a tree this young beyond the genus.

The leaves of Erythina are large, but in time they can be reduced somewhat.  Here is a link to a web page with a photo of an Erythina bonsai, it is the third picture: http://www.fukubonsai.com/1a9a26.html.  And here is another web page which shows another Erythrina used as bonsai, the photo is about midway down the page: http://www.stonelantern.co.za/galleries/tygerberg-kai-bonsai-show-2013/#.V-RzIvArKUk.
